How Does BenQ HDRi Increase Your Immersion?

HDR content increases every day, so HDR support is a spec many buyers want in a monitor. You should note that this effect varies between different models and manufacturers. HDRi, BenQ’s proprietary technology, enhances the standard effect by integrating adaptive tech. Its intelligent control detects the current ambient light level and then automatically adjusts screen brightness for the ideal viewing experience. Viewers can see clearly what’s being shown on the monitor. It’s the combination of innovation and increased user control which creates the most immersive experience to date.

Intelligent Brightness and Contrast Control

HDR increases contrast and details with brightness effects. By introducing custom modes suited to different content, BenQ HDRi lets you match the effect to what you’re watching. The graph below shows how brightness and contrast vary between modes. These subtle differences take the viewing experience from ordinary to extraordinary.

Brightness and contrast vary between HDR, Game HDRi and Cinema HDRi

Figure 1: Cinema HDRi offers better contrast and more details.

 

HDR refines details by raising brightness. This can result in overexposed bright areas on the display. Fortunately, BenQ developed a fix.

Game HDRi increases the contrast and saturation of red tones, which is essential for many game elements, such as human skin or rocks, bricks, leather, and fire, making these elements more realistic and vivid. GameHDRi also improves the overall brightness and clarity of the game scenes, creating a more engaging gaming experience.

Cinema HDRi aims to achieve a realistic viewing experience by adjusting the color balance and contrast levels of each pixel. This results in a stable and consistent color performance across different scenes and lighting conditions. Cinema HDRi also boosts the contrast ratio between the darkest and brightest areas of the screen, creating a deeper sense of depth and dimension. With Cinema HDRi, viewers can enjoy a more vivid and lifelike display of content.

Vivid Colors

Besides better contrast and more details, BenQ HDRi technology also offers more saturated colors. This makes colors richer and more vivid. This is because the BenQ Color Engine allows each color to be enhanced in depth and hue. For example, in Cinema mode, the color blue can become more vivid than in other modes. All this attention to color results in viewing experiences that make you love what you watch and glad you watched it on a BenQ monitor.
